  • Knuckle boom cranes use an articulated boom with multiple jointed sections, allowing them to fold compactly and reach into tight or obstructed spaces that straight boom cranes cannot access. They are widely used across construction, logistics and utility work because their precise load control and compact setup footprint improve efficiency and reduce repositioning on crowded job sites.
